being purple yeah it's um actually
everyone will see it being purple
because the red blue and green lights
are turning on and off so quickly after
each other that your brain actually
merges it into one color when the ball
is in one place so the eye actually kind
of holds the information there about
what color it's seeing for an instant
longer than it's there and it merges
together to produce that purple color
yeah that red blue and green kind of
merge to this Dusty violet color Dusty
Violet Dusty Violet you know your color
should be a pain on why can we see them
separated when you swirl it in a circle
when I Swirl It In A Circle I'm actually
getting the ball to switch colors to Red
to green to blue at different points in
space so at different points in space
your eye is not actually holding that
image as it switches to a different
color right so even if the eye remembers
the color that it's seen it's not going
to merge with the next color because
that occurs at a different point in
space exactly so it's much easier to see
the red blue and green lights happening
in the bow than it
